Title: Analisis Pendapatan dan Kelayakan Usahatani Kakao (Theobroma Cacao L) Rakyat (Studi Kasus : Desa Hilihambawa Kecamatan Gunungsitoli Idanoi Kota Gunungsitoli)
Other Titles: Income and Feasibility Analysis of People's Cocoa (Theobroma Cacao L) Farming (Case Study: Hilihambawa Village, Gunungsitoli Idanoi District, Gunungsitoli City)

Abstract: Usahatani tanaman kakao merupakan salah satu sumber pendapatan petani dengan cara mempertahankan serta meningkatkan produksi yang dihasilkan. Penelitian ini bertujuan untuk mengetahui besar pendapatan dan kelayakan usahatani kakao di kakao (Theobroma Cacao L.) rakyat (Studi Kasus Desa Hilihambawa Kecamatan Gunungsitoli Idanoi Kota Gunungsitoli). Pengambilan sampel dilakukan dengan teknik Sensus dimana jumlah sampel yang diambil sebanyak 25 orang petani kakao yang berasal dari keseluruhan populasi yang ada. Adapun analisis data yamg di gunakan dalam penelitian ini menggunakan analisis dengan metode deskriktif kuantitatif. Hasil perhitungan pendapatan pada usahatani kakao rakyat di Desa Hilihambawa dimana di ketahui bahwa rata-rata penerimaan yang diperoleh oleh para petani responden dalam satu kali masa panen yaitu sebesar Rp 3.095.840 serta total pengeluran atau biaya yang dikeluarkan rata-rata berjumlah Rp 2.417.859 setiap musim panen dan memperoleh pendapatan rata-rata sebesar Rp 677.983 setiap petani responden setiap kali panen serta usahatani tanaman kakao masih dinyatakan layak untuk di usahakan serta terus dikembangkan kedepannya berdasarkan hasil dari uji kelayakan yang telah dilakukan dimana pada hasil uji R/C ratio, B/C ratio, dan BEP serta NVP yang sudah dilakukan menunjukan bahwa usahatanitani tanaman kakao rakyat ini yang diusahakan oleh para petani di lokasi penelitian masih layak dikembangkan dengan nilai uji diatas 1 berdasarkan analisis R/C ratio, BEP harga serta NPV dan tidak layak berdasarkan uji B/C dan BEP produksi. Cocoa farming is one source of income for farmers by maintaining and increasing the production they produce. This research aims to determine the income and feasibility of cocoa farming in cocoa (Theobroma Cacao L.) people (Case Study of Hilihambawa Village, Gunungsitoli Idanoi District, Gunungsitoli City). Sampling was carried out using the Census technique where the number of samples taken was 25 cocoa farmers from the entire population. Meanwhile, the data analysis used in this research uses analysis using quantitative descriptive methods. The results of income calculations for people's cocoa farming in Hilihambawa Village show that the average income obtained by respondent farmers in one harvest period is IDR 3,095,840 and the total expenditure or costs incurred are an average of IDR 2,417,859 per harvest season and earn an average income of Rp. 677,983 per respondent farmer each time they harvest and cocoa farming is still declared suitable for cultivation and will continue to be developed in the future based on the results of the feasibility test that has been carried out where the results of the R/C ratio, B/C test Ratio, and BEP and NVP that have been carried out show that the smallholder cocoa farming cultivated by farmers in the research location is still feasible to develop with a test value above 1 based on the R/C Ratio, BEP Price and NPV analysis and is not feasible based on the B/test. C and BEP production.
